About this House

This is a 3-level, 3bd/3.5ba Wardman-style row house with a spacious open concept living area that is great for entertaining. The modern kitchen has stainless steel appliances and premium countertops. The upstairs has two bedrooms, two full bathrooms, washer and dryer, plus a den that could be used as an office, rec room, or guest room. The master bedroom suite boasts a vaulted ceiling, lots of sunlight, and attached master bathroom. The fully finished basement is an ideal in-law suite. It comes complete with its own separate front and rear entrance, a bedroom, full bath, full kitchen, and additional washer and dryer.

The entire home is distinguished by its signature bamboo flooring, open and airy layout, recessed lighting, and crown moldings. The inside living area is complemented by a lovely front porch, back deck, and a backyard that is ready for outdoor parties, complete with a grapevine covered pergola, outdoor kegerator, and deck and brick patio. There is a detached garage in the backyard with an electric car charging port. Nestled in the vibrant H Street Corridor, this home places residents near Union Market and steps away from a host of eclectic restaurants and bars, some of which are on best of lists.
